lightweight hand therapy glove
The lightweight hand therapy glove represents a revolutionary advancement in rehabilitation technology, designed to support patients recovering from hand injuries, strokes, arthritis, and various neurological conditions. This innovative medical device combines cutting-edge sensor technology with therapeutic functionality to deliver comprehensive hand rehabilitation solutions. The lightweight hand therapy glove incorporates flexible sensors that monitor hand movement patterns, grip strength, and finger dexterity while providing real-time feedback to both patients and healthcare providers. Its ergonomic design ensures maximum comfort during extended therapy sessions, featuring breathable materials that prevent moisture buildup and skin irritation. The glove utilizes advanced haptic feedback mechanisms to guide users through prescribed exercises, creating an interactive rehabilitation experience that enhances patient engagement and motivation. Bluetooth connectivity enables seamless integration with mobile applications and clinical management systems, allowing therapists to track progress remotely and adjust treatment protocols accordingly. The lightweight hand therapy glove features adjustable tension settings that accommodate varying degrees of motor impairment, from mild weakness to severe paralysis. Its modular design allows for customization based on individual patient needs, with interchangeable components that target specific muscle groups and movement patterns. The device incorporates machine learning algorithms that adapt to user performance, automatically adjusting difficulty levels to ensure optimal therapeutic progression. Safety features include automatic shutoff mechanisms and pressure monitoring systems that prevent overexertion and tissue damage. The lightweight hand therapy glove supports both active and passive rehabilitation exercises, making it suitable for patients across all recovery stages. Clinical applications span multiple medical specialties, including occupational therapy, physical therapy, neurology, and orthopedics, demonstrating its versatility as a comprehensive rehabilitation tool.
